/ / Come leggere correttamente il codice a barre generato da Barcode128 - java, scanner di codici a barre

Come leggere correttamente il codice a barre generato da Barcode128 - java, scanner di codici a barre

Creo con la libreria iText alcuni codici a barre. Quindi quando provo a leggere questi codici a barre dal lettore di codici a barre non tutti i codici a barre sono pronti correttamente.

Ad esempio, ho questo codice a barre:

M-254, il codice a barre leggeva M "254.

Ma se provo a leggere questo codice a barre con l'applicazione ios questa applicazione è pronta M-254.

perché sta succedendo?

Questo è il codice che uso per creare una barra

Barcode128 codeEAN = new Barcode128();
codeEAN.setCode("M-254");
codeEAN.setGuardBars(false);
codeEAN.setBarHeight(40f); // great! but what about width???
codeEAN.setX(1f);
Image img = codeEAN.createImageWithBarcode(cb, null, null);
img.scaleAbsoluteWidth(90f);

risposte:

2 per risposta № 1

Poiché l'app funziona correttamente, non penso che sia un problema del codice a barre.

Penso che lo scanner di codici a barre che utilizzi con il PC sia configurato in modo errato o che la lingua di input / font sul PC non renda correttamente il simbolo "-".